How do you write 88% as a fraction

Mathematics
1 answer:
KengaRu [80]2 years ago
7 0

Answer:

\frac{88}{100} or \frac{22}{25}

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Any percentage automatically has 100 as a denominator. It's 88 out of 100. So, we can start off with that.</u>

\frac{88}{100}

<u>We can leave this just like that, but if your assignment asks for the simplified form, keep reading.</u>

<u>Now, to simplify a fraction, we have to find common factors. Finding the greatest common factor will be the smoothest route.</u>

Factors of 88: 1, 2, 4, 8, 11, 22, 44, 88

Factors of 100: 1, 2, 4, 5, 10, 20, 25, 50, 100

<u>Now that we've listed our factors, we can see that 4 is the greatest common factor. So, let's divide both </u><u>top and bottom</u><u> by 4.</u>

<u />\frac{22}{25}<u />

<u>To check if we can simplify further, we'll look for another greatest common factor.</u>

Factors of 22: 1, 2, 11, 22

Factors of 25: 1, 5, 25

<u>The only factor shared is 1. Therefore, </u>\frac{22}{25}<u> is the lowest we can simplify.</u>
